MapRouteRouteBuilderExtensions.MapRoute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Sobrecargas
MapRoute(IRouteBuilder, String, String) |
Adiciona uma rota ao IRouteBuilder com o nome e o modelo especificados. |
MapRoute(IRouteBuilder, String, String, Object) |
Adiciona uma rota ao IRouteBuilder com o nome, o modelo e os valores padrão especificados. |
MapRoute(IRouteBuilder, String, String, Object, Object) |
Adiciona uma rota à IRouteBuilder com o nome, o modelo, os valores padrão e as restrições especificados. |
MapRoute(IRouteBuilder, String, String, Object, Object, Object) |
Adiciona uma rota à IRouteBuilder com o nome, o modelo, os valores padrão e os tokens de dados especificados. |
MapRoute(IRouteBuilder, String, String)
Adiciona uma rota ao IRouteBuilder com o nome e o modelo especificados.
public:
[System::Runtime::CompilerServices::Extension]
static Microsoft::AspNetCore::Routing::IRouteBuilder ^ MapRoute(Microsoft::AspNetCore::Routing::IRouteBuilder ^ routeBuilder, System::String ^ name, System::String ^ template);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string name, string template);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string? name, string? template);
static member MapRoute : Microsoft.AspNetCore.Routing.IRouteBuilder * string * string -> Microsoft.AspNetCore.Routing.IRouteBuilder
<Extension()>
Public Function MapRoute (routeBuilder As IRouteBuilder, name As String, template As String) As IRouteBuilder
Parâmetros
- routeBuilder
- IRouteBuilder
O IRouteBuilder para o qual adicionar a rota.
- name
- String
O nome da rota.
- template
- String
O padrão de URL da rota.
Retornos
Uma referência a essa instância após a conclusão da operação.
Aplica-se a
MapRoute(IRouteBuilder, String, String, Object)
Adiciona uma rota ao IRouteBuilder com o nome, o modelo e os valores padrão especificados.
public:
[System::Runtime::CompilerServices::Extension]
static Microsoft::AspNetCore::Routing::IRouteBuilder ^ MapRoute(Microsoft::AspNetCore::Routing::IRouteBuilder ^ routeBuilder, System::String ^ name, System::String ^ template, System::Object ^ defaults);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string name, string template, object defaults);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string? name, string? template, object? defaults);
static member MapRoute : Microsoft.AspNetCore.Routing.IRouteBuilder * string * string * obj -> Microsoft.AspNetCore.Routing.IRouteBuilder
<Extension()>
Public Function MapRoute (routeBuilder As IRouteBuilder, name As String, template As String, defaults As Object) As IRouteBuilder
Parâmetros
- routeBuilder
- IRouteBuilder
O IRouteBuilder para o qual adicionar a rota.
- name
- String
O nome da rota.
- template
- String
O padrão de URL da rota.
- defaults
- Object
Um objeto que contém valores padrão para parâmetros de rota. As propriedades do objeto representam os nomes e valores dos valores padrão.
Retornos
Uma referência a essa instância após a conclusão da operação.
Aplica-se a
MapRoute(IRouteBuilder, String, String, Object, Object)
Adiciona uma rota à IRouteBuilder com o nome, o modelo, os valores padrão e as restrições especificados.
public:
[System::Runtime::CompilerServices::Extension]
static Microsoft::AspNetCore::Routing::IRouteBuilder ^ MapRoute(Microsoft::AspNetCore::Routing::IRouteBuilder ^ routeBuilder, System::String ^ name, System::String ^ template, System::Object ^ defaults, System::Object ^ constraints);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string name, string template, object defaults, object constraints);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string? name, string? template, object? defaults, object? constraints);
static member MapRoute : Microsoft.AspNetCore.Routing.IRouteBuilder * string * string * obj * obj -> Microsoft.AspNetCore.Routing.IRouteBuilder
<Extension()>
Public Function MapRoute (routeBuilder As IRouteBuilder, name As String, template As String, defaults As Object, constraints As Object) As IRouteBuilder
Parâmetros
- routeBuilder
- IRouteBuilder
O IRouteBuilder para o qual adicionar a rota.
- name
- String
O nome da rota.
- template
- String
O padrão de URL da rota.
- defaults
- Object
Um objeto que contém valores padrão para parâmetros de rota. As propriedades do objeto representam os nomes e valores dos valores padrão.
- constraints
- Object
Um objeto que contém restrições para a rota. As propriedades do objeto representam os nomes e valores das restrições.
Retornos
Uma referência a essa instância após a conclusão da operação.
Aplica-se a
MapRoute(IRouteBuilder, String, String, Object, Object, Object)
Adiciona uma rota à IRouteBuilder com o nome, o modelo, os valores padrão e os tokens de dados especificados.
public:
[System::Runtime::CompilerServices::Extension]
static Microsoft::AspNetCore::Routing::IRouteBuilder ^ MapRoute(Microsoft::AspNetCore::Routing::IRouteBuilder ^ routeBuilder, System::String ^ name, System::String ^ template, System::Object ^ defaults, System::Object ^ constraints, System::Object ^ dataTokens);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string name, string template, object defaults, object constraints, object dataTokens);
public static Microsoft.AspNetCore.Routing.IRouteBuilder MapRoute (this Microsoft.AspNetCore.Routing.IRouteBuilder routeBuilder, string? name, string? template, object? defaults, object? constraints, object? dataTokens);
static member MapRoute : Microsoft.AspNetCore.Routing.IRouteBuilder * string * string * obj * obj * obj -> Microsoft.AspNetCore.Routing.IRouteBuilder
<Extension()>
Public Function MapRoute (routeBuilder As IRouteBuilder, name As String, template As String, defaults As Object, constraints As Object, dataTokens As Object) As IRouteBuilder
Parâmetros
- routeBuilder
- IRouteBuilder
O IRouteBuilder para o qual adicionar a rota.
- name
- String
O nome da rota.
- template
- String
O padrão de URL da rota.
- defaults
- Object
Um objeto que contém valores padrão para parâmetros de rota. As propriedades do objeto representam os nomes e valores dos valores padrão.
- constraints
- Object
Um objeto que contém restrições para a rota. As propriedades do objeto representam os nomes e valores das restrições.
- dataTokens
- Object
Um objeto que contém tokens de dados para a rota. As propriedades do objeto representam os nomes e valores dos tokens de dados.
Retornos
Uma referência a essa instância após a conclusão da operação.